Bharat Forge launches QIP at floor price of ₹1,948 per share

CNBC-TV18 1 hr ago·17 Sept 2026, 1:44 pm

Bharat Forge has initiated a Qualified Institutional Placement (QIP) to raise fresh capital, setting the issue price at ₹1,948 per share. This move allows the company to issue new equity to institutional investors, providing it with immediate liquidity to fund its growth plans and reduce debt.

For investors, the QIP is a strategic step that strengthens the company's financial position. While the share price at the time of the announcement is higher than the current market rate, it signals management's confidence in the stock's long-term value. The dilution of existing shareholders' stake will depend on the final size of the issue.

Investors should monitor the subscription response from institutional buyers and the company's future capital allocation strategy. A strong uptake could support the stock, whereas a lackluster response might put pressure on the price. Watch for updates on the final allotment and the specific use of the raised funds.
